Job description

EVENTS SUPERVISOR - Holland Civic Center

HCC SFM, LLC

LOCATION: Holland, MI

DEPARTMENT: EVENTS

REPORTS TO: EVENTS MANAGER

STATUS: FULL-TIME (NON-EXEMPT)

Position Summary

The Events Supervisor will be responsible for assisting management of events and supporting facility management. This position provides direction in training and development opportunities to full-time and part-time staff for and during events. The Events Supervisor will work with outside event owners and other leaders in order to successfully accomplish these responsibilities.

PRIMARY RESPONSIBILITIES WILL INCLUDE, BUT ARE NOT LIMITED TO THE FOLLOWING:
  • Assist in developing, maintaining, and reporting on overall event calendar activities to leadership, team members, clients, and SFC
  • Participates in planning/strategic and leadership meetings
  • Assist with oversight effective communications with event owners pre, during, and post events
  • Assist in oversight with administration and a high level of detail is required in the organization of events
  • Builds an overall understanding of the events in the company portfolio, their operational aims, and their revenue streams
  • Plan, develop, and execute local tournaments including sales and marketing strategy to meet registration goals and being tournament director
  • Liaison and communication for event planning, setup, and operations with other departments leaders
  • During non-event days, work with Operations Supervisor to oversee event management ensuring everyone is prepared for next event, including but not limited to task assignment and execution of facility team's daily tasks
  • Support facility team in day-to-day tasks, such as mowing, weed eating, field prep, irrigation maintenance, etc.
  • Assist to ensure overall health & safety, quality control, expense management, security, procedures, and facility maintenance are in place
  • Creates and monitors operations and facility team schedules
  • Contributes to maintaining budgets while exercises control in expense management and facility maintenance
  • Analyze event performance and prepare metrics presentation
  • Support in hiring process, train, and lead part-time/seasonal operations and facilities team members
  • Works with Event Operations Manager and other leaders to develop business plan, KPI reports and budgets
  • Serves as MOD on duty as needed
  • Additional duties assigned by management
Minimum Qualifications
  • Bachelor's degree in management, sports management, business, or related field with 3-5 years of experience in a leadership role in operational management and/or event management preferred
  • Must have excellent interpersonal, project management, and problem-solving skills
  • Must be a team player
  • Must have excellent verbal and written communication skills
  • Must have excellent computer skills, including Word, Excel, PowerPoint, etc.
  • Must be able to work flexible schedules including weekends, nights, and holidays
  • Must be willing to obtain CPR certifications
  • Well organized, efficient, flexible, and able to meet deadlines
  • Able to cope with many tasks at once and work to tight schedules
Working Conditions And Physical Demands
  • Must be able to lift 50 pounds waist high
  • May be required to sit or stand for extended periods of time in various conditions
  • Limited travel may be required
  • Weekends, nights and holidays required
